如何在MySQL中临时禁用外键的检查

使用MySQL数据库时必定会面临很多次的外键约束的问题。通常问题会发生在删除,插入记录,备份并恢复数据库和删除数据库表期间。在这种情况下很难完成操作。 MySQL提供了一个选项在表或数据库的任何操作过程中禁用外键检查。您可以禁用检查并完成你的任务没有任何问题。 本文将帮助在MySQL中如何启用或禁用外键检查。如果你面对外键错误,禁用外键检查,完成后可以再次启用它。

禁用外键检查

SET FOREIGN_KEY_CHECKS=0;

启用外键检查

SET FOREIGN_KEY_CHECKS=1;
记住了,千万不要忘了做完你的工作后,重新启用外键检查。
赞(52) 打赏
未经允许不得转载:优客志 » 系统运维
分享到:

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

微信扫一扫打赏